Having been presented with an ASUS X55SR notebook, I want to install Windows XP on it. Its video adapter is ATI Mobility Radeon HD 3470. Has anybody been able to install a driver for it in XP, and how? Having seen reports that the 3450 works on XP, e.g.:

swaaye wrote on 2009-10-08, 20:04:

Also, I tried out JK1 on my notebook with a Radeon 3450 and it ran fine in XP 32-bit.

I am willing to try the 3450 driver the way swaaye did, but he did not explain his procedure. Nor do I think that either the 3470 or the 3450 have officially supported drivers for Windows XP. At least, I have not found these models mentioned in the serveral driver packs I checked, e.g. 13-1_xp32_dd_ccc_whql.exe and 13-4_xp32_dd_ccc_whql.exe. Over on Reddit, I read this trick for installing a driver for the 3450 by modifying the .inf file, but did not understand it. Can someone help?

I have found the driver in Microsoft Update Catalog, and uploaded it elsewhere¹, just in case. I confirm that it works in Windows XP Professional SP3.
